Navigating the Challenges of Male Health
Men face unique challenges when it comes to their health. Often, societal expectations discourage them from seeking assistance, leading to delayed diagnoses and neglected conditions. Rigid views on masculinity can also prevent open conversations about mental well-being, creating a barrier to proactive health management.
It's crucial for men to recognize these difficulties and take measures to prioritize their health. Routine checkups, a balanced diet, sufficient exercise, and vulnerable communication with healthcare providers are all key components of achieving optimal male health.

Achieving optimal male health involves regular diligence and preventative measures. Start by adopting a wholesome diet rich in fruits, vegetables, and lean proteins. Incorporate frequent physical activity into your routine.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ise most days of the week. Prioritize adequate sleep, aiming for 7-8 hours nightly to renew your body and mind.
Regularly schedule exams with your doctor to assess your overall health and address any potential issues. Control stress through coping mechanisms such as exercise, meditation, or spending here time in nature.
- Reduce alcohol consumption and avoid tobacco use entirely.
- Engage in safe sex practices to prevent sexually transmitted infections.
- Remain informed about men's health issues and consult for professional help when needed.
